Micromagnetic properties of MnAs(0001)/GaAs(111) epitaxial films

Abstract:
The micromagnetic properties of MnAs thin films grown on the (111)B-oriented GaAs surface have been investigated. Compared to films grown on (001) surfaces, these films exhibit completely different domain patterns, as the c axis of the hexagonal unit cell is oriented normal to the surface. In the course of the first order phase transition, ferromagnetic α -MnAs forms a network of quasihexagonal areas separated by Β -MnAs. We present an analysis of the micromagnetic properties based on imaging and simulations. We observe closure domains that either appear as a vortex-like state or a stripe structure. © 2006 American Institute of Physics.
